I have found that following the swing line is just a simple 7-1 swing and you will get a slight fade or draw, its nothing really extreme unless you want to swing 8-2 or even more. Yes its hard to perfectly replicate that line but the swing plane is only little bit off a north/south swing. Just keep practicing and it should get easier. If you get the historic edition then you will have the practice range to tinker with it as much as you want.

The key, just like real golf, is to not to swing too hard because that's when everything can go bonkers. It's all about tempo. Take an easy swing back and forth until it becomes second nature and when you get comfortable increase your speed but you still don't need to flick it really hard to get good distance. This swing is meant to be measured as well as accurate. Flicking it hard forward will hurt your tempo and makes it more difficult to have a diagonal straight line and the devs have stated that tempo is a factor with accuracy, its less forgiving when your tempo is bad.

I've heard it mentioned that a couple of the devs are scratch golfers. I'm a scratch golfer too, actually a little better than that.

When you have a wedge in your you ARE trying to hit a straight shot, I was kind of surprised in the demo when coming in with wedges to still see the extreme fade path. It's HARD to draw or fade a wedge, lol, if I draw a sand wedge it's not on purpose.

So I was a little disappointed to see that, just like in real golf when you're in that scoring zone you're going right at the flag, not shaping a wedge in there. I was having a tough time hitting fairways then when I had a wedge in I was expecting to see the game give me the 6-12 o'clock shot.

Even with the shorter irons the ball will move less. In real life I hit a draw automatically, don't even have to think about it and my draw will draw a few more yards the longer the club. I think the game should reflect those small variations instead of 6-12 or 5-7, some variations in between.

Sometimes I would just spin the controller a bit so my thumb can just go 6-12 and hit the 5-7, but it feels like cheating, lol so I suck it up for the most part.
